In Tennessee, you can be charged with a DUI for drugs if law enforcement believes you were impaired while operating a vehicle due to illegal drugs, prescription medications, or over-the-counter substances. Unlike alcohol-related DUIs, there is no legal limit for drug impairment, making these cases highly subjective. Prosecutors rely on field sobriety tests, blood tests, and drug recognition experts to prove impairment. A first-time DUI-D conviction carries penalties including a mandatory minimum of 48 hours in jail (or seven days if drugs were found in your system), fines ranging from $350 to $1,500, a one-year license suspension, and mandatory drug education programs. A second or third offense leads to longer jail time, higher fines, and extended license suspension periods. A fourth DUI-D is a felony, carrying at least one year in prison and indefinite license revocation. Even if you were taking a legally prescribed medication, you can still be charged with DUI-D if it impaired your ability to drive safely. However, a skilled DUI attorney can challenge the validity of drug test results, the legality of the traffic stop, and the methods used to determine impairment to fight for reduced charges or case dismissal.
